摘要
元胞自动机法是一种模拟金属凝固过程微观组织的有效方法,是目前的研究热点,具有广阔的应用前景。对比了元胞自动机法与通常所用相场法的区别,综述了近年来用元胞自动机法模拟合金凝固微观组织的国内外研究现状,分析了当前急待解决的主要问题,并指出了今后的发展方向。
Cellular automata method is an effective method for the simulation of metal solidification microstructure, and the current research hotspot. It has broad prospects for application. The difference between cellular automata method and phase field method was contrasted. In recent years, research situation of simulation of solidification microstructure in China and abroad by the cellular automata was summarized. At present the main problems to resolve were analyzed and the future directions of research were also pointed out.
